Amar Kaanane is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Food Science and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Amar Kaanane has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 668 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Food Science and 2 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Amar Kaanane’s work include Protein Hydrolysis and Bioactive Peptides (3 papers), Edible Oils Quality and Analysis (2 papers) and Food Quality and Safety Studies (2 papers). Amar Kaanane is often cited by papers focused on Protein Hydrolysis and Bioactive Peptides (3 papers), Edible Oils Quality and Analysis (2 papers) and Food Quality and Safety Studies (2 papers). Amar Kaanane collaborates with scholars based in United States and Morocco. Amar Kaanane's co-authors include Theodore P. Labuza, Chris Kinsley, Anna Crolla, T. P. Labuza, M. El-Otmani and C.J. Lovatt and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Food Science, Water Science & Technology and Current Opinion in Green and Sustainable Chemistry.
